The Department of Rheumatology at Albany Medical Center includes providers who are experts in their field. They have extensive training and experience in the diagnosis and treatment of arthritis, certain autoimmune diseases, musculoskeletal pain disorders, osteoporosis, and other diseases of the joints, muscles, and bones.

There are over 100 types of rheumatic diseases which can be serious and very difficult to diagnose and treat. Symptoms can vary from patient to patient and the experts at Albany Med work collectively to address each patient's needs and provide the best possible care.
